RONALD HINTON CONVICTED OF FIRST-DEGREE MURDER AND RAPE

 

Baltimore, MD – May 6, 2008 – Today a Baltimore jury convicted Ronald Hinton, 16, of the 5300 block of Morello Road, Baltimore of first-degree murder and rape of 4-yr. old Ja’Niya Williams.  The Honorable John Addison Howard will sentence Hinton at a later date.  Closing arguments were held on Friday, May 2, 2008 and the jury deliberated less than 3 hours before returning their verdict about 11 AM this morning following an 8-day trial.

 

The Baltimore City Grand jury indicted Hinton July 7, 2006 for first-degree murder, first-degree rape and other sex offense and child abuse counts.

 

Court documents allege on June 21, 2006 Hinton, who was 14 at the time, raped and severely beat a four-year old girl at a residence in the 2900 block of Goodwood Road.  Ja’Niya Williams died two days later.

 

Assistant State’s Attorney Temmi Rollock and Sex Offense Division Chief Jo Anne Stanton prosecuted the case.
